You're working on a secret team solving coded transmissions.
Your team is scrambling to decipher a recent message, worried it's a plot to break into a major European National Cake Vault. The message has been mostly deciphered, but all the words are backward! Your colleagues have handed off the last step to you.
Write a functionreverseWords that takes a message as a string and reverses the order of the words in place.
